fre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

低頻模擬信號(hào)波形顯示分析器設(shè)計(jì)的論文-文庫吧資料

2024-08-19 12:37本頁面
  

【正文】 +5V 對(duì)電容 C 充電導(dǎo)致 RST 端電壓迅速下降使它變?yōu)榈碗娖?,單片機(jī)開始工作。s。本設(shè)計(jì)中晶振頻率 fosc=12MHz 時(shí),機(jī)器周期T=1181。s)。工作過程中引腳 Reset 一旦接收到一個(gè)正脈沖,就會(huì)再次進(jìn)行復(fù)位啟動(dòng)。也就是說單片機(jī)接收正脈沖開始復(fù)位,在正脈沖的下降沿啟動(dòng)單片機(jī)。Vin VoutGNDU1 C2C4LED1234P1USB 33pFC515pFC615pFC7VBUSD+D10uFC11uFC3+1 23 45 6P2( 電源開關(guān)按鍵 1)+5VDD+GND+5VR427R227R31KR1GND++ 圖 23 C8051F340供電電路 西安工程大學(xué)本科畢業(yè)設(shè)計(jì) (論文 ) 16 復(fù)位電路 單片機(jī)的復(fù)位包括初始化和從頭開始工作這樣連續(xù)的兩步。其中的 D+、 D_分別要接到單片機(jī)的 9 引腳。其原理圖如圖 22 所示。 西安工程大學(xué)本科畢業(yè)設(shè)計(jì) (論文 ) 14 C 8 0 5 1 F 3 4 0U S BP C 機(jī)供 電 電 路 復(fù) 位 電 路J T A G時(shí) 鐘 電 路被 測(cè) 信 號(hào) 圖 21系統(tǒng)總體功能流程圖 硬件詳細(xì)設(shè)計(jì) 本小節(jié)主要介紹硬件電路中各自包含的大小模塊的具體電路及電路中個(gè)元器件的選擇等。該模塊主要包括供電電路、時(shí)鐘電路、復(fù)位電路、 JTAG 電路。 硬件功能主要是搭建下位機(jī)的 C8051F340 單片機(jī)系統(tǒng)構(gòu)成。 硬件功能描述 硬件設(shè)計(jì)是整個(gè)系統(tǒng)設(shè)計(jì)的基礎(chǔ),是軟件運(yùn)行的平臺(tái)。本章主要對(duì)測(cè)試系統(tǒng)硬件的功能、測(cè)試系統(tǒng)硬件總體設(shè)計(jì)、測(cè)試系統(tǒng)硬件詳細(xì)設(shè)計(jì)進(jìn)行介紹。 第五章是系 統(tǒng)設(shè)計(jì)的結(jié)論與展望,在這一章中,結(jié)論對(duì)系統(tǒng)的設(shè)計(jì)結(jié)果作了簡(jiǎn)單的總結(jié),展望則根據(jù)系統(tǒng)中存在的不足提出了一些相應(yīng)的改進(jìn)的方法 。主要分為上位機(jī)和下位機(jī)兩部分具體進(jìn)行了說明。 第二章是系統(tǒng)硬件設(shè)計(jì)的介紹,包括了 C8051F340 硬件的功能描述和硬件的總體設(shè)計(jì)和詳細(xì)設(shè)計(jì)。驗(yàn)證 LabVIEW 界面功能對(duì) LabVIEW 界面的檢測(cè)實(shí)際是對(duì)上位機(jī)的整體檢測(cè),通過 LabVIEW 界面信號(hào)顯示和頻譜的顯示進(jìn)而確保整個(gè)設(shè)計(jì)的初步 成功。在運(yùn)用 LabVIEW 之前檢測(cè)自己設(shè)計(jì)的方案時(shí),必須先保證上位機(jī)設(shè)計(jì)的合理性與成功性,為此我們必須先對(duì)其進(jìn)行 USB 通信的檢測(cè),進(jìn)而保證后面實(shí)驗(yàn)的可行性。如今LabVIEW 已應(yīng)用到航空、電子、通信、工業(yè)、醫(yī)學(xué)等領(lǐng)域。 LabVIEW 簡(jiǎn)介 LabVIEW( Laboratory Virtual Instrument Engineering Workbench,實(shí)驗(yàn)室虛擬儀器開發(fā)平臺(tái))是美國 NI( National Instrument Company)公司推出的一種基于G 語言的虛擬軟件開發(fā)工具,虛擬儀器是有用戶定義,這種 “軟件即儀器 ”的思想增強(qiáng)了虛擬儀器的靈活性和可擴(kuò)展性 [15]。另外重要的一點(diǎn)是 Keil C51 生成的目標(biāo)代碼效率非常之高,多數(shù)語句生成的匯編代碼很緊湊,容易理解。用過匯編語言后再使用 C 來開發(fā),體會(huì)更加深刻。 本次所用示波器如下圖 : 西安工程大學(xué)本科畢業(yè)設(shè)計(jì) (論文 ) 11 圖 17示波器 軟件環(huán)境 1.、 單片機(jī)開發(fā)軟件 Keil C51 簡(jiǎn)介 Keil C51 是美國 Keil Software 公司出品的 51 系列兼容單片機(jī) C 語言軟件開發(fā)系統(tǒng)。它是觀察數(shù)字電路實(shí)驗(yàn)現(xiàn)象、分析實(shí)驗(yàn)中的問題、測(cè)量實(shí)驗(yàn)結(jié)果必不可少的重要儀器。萬用表和邏輯筆使用方法比較簡(jiǎn)單,而邏輯分析儀和存儲(chǔ)示波器目前在數(shù)字電路教學(xué)實(shí)驗(yàn)中應(yīng)用還不十分普遍。在數(shù)字電路實(shí)驗(yàn)中,需要使用若干儀器、儀表觀察實(shí)驗(yàn)現(xiàn)象和結(jié)果。 C8051F340/1/2/3/4/5/6/7采用 48腳 TQFP封裝或 32腳 LQFP封裝。對(duì)于 USB通信,電源電壓最小值為。 每種器件都可在工業(yè)溫度范圍( 45℃ 到 +85℃ )內(nèi)用 。在使用 C2進(jìn)行調(diào)試時(shí),所有的模擬和數(shù)字外設(shè)都可全功能運(yùn)行。 片內(nèi) Silicon Labs二線( C2)開 發(fā)接口允許使用安裝在最終應(yīng)用系統(tǒng)上的產(chǎn)品MCU進(jìn)行非侵入式(不占用片內(nèi)資源)、全速、在系統(tǒng)調(diào)試。 FLASH存儲(chǔ)器還具有在系統(tǒng)重新編程能力,可用于非易失性數(shù)據(jù)存儲(chǔ),并允許現(xiàn)場(chǎng)更新 8051固件。 西安工程大學(xué)本科畢業(yè)設(shè)計(jì) (論文 ) 9 多達(dá) 40個(gè)端口 I/O(容許 5V輸入) 。 具有 5個(gè)捕捉 /比較模塊和看門狗定時(shí)器功能的 可編程計(jì)數(shù)器 /定時(shí)器陣列( PCA) 。 多達(dá) 4352字節(jié)片內(nèi) RAM( 256+4KB) 。 精確校準(zhǔn)的 12MHz內(nèi)部振蕩器和 4倍時(shí)鐘乘法器 。 片內(nèi)電壓基準(zhǔn)和和溫度傳感器 。 電源穩(wěn)壓器 。 全速、非侵入式的在系統(tǒng)調(diào)試接口(片內(nèi)) 。下面列出了一些主要特性 [7] 。通過以上設(shè)計(jì)系統(tǒng)構(gòu)架框圖如圖 13如所示。下面將對(duì)系統(tǒng)的硬件構(gòu)架和軟件開發(fā)環(huán)境作已簡(jiǎn)單介紹。 上位機(jī)上 PC機(jī)端的 GUI界面主要利用 LabVIEW做成虛擬示波器,進(jìn) 行波形顯示、頻譜分。 系統(tǒng)方案設(shè)計(jì) 系統(tǒng)功能 在本設(shè)計(jì)中需要能夠?qū)崿F(xiàn)功能如下: 下位機(jī)上利用 C8051F340單片機(jī)對(duì)數(shù)據(jù)的采樣。 在 VI設(shè)計(jì)過程中,可以利用工具選板、前面板中的控件選板、程序框圖中的函數(shù)選板進(jìn)行設(shè)計(jì)。圖標(biāo)與連接器在這里相當(dāng)于圖形化的參數(shù)。在許多情況下,使用 VI可以仿真標(biāo)準(zhǔn)儀器,不僅在屏幕上出現(xiàn)一個(gè)惟妙惟肖的標(biāo)準(zhǔn)儀器面板,而且其功能也與標(biāo)準(zhǔn)儀器相差無幾。它包括前面板上的控件和控件的 連線端子,還有一些前面板上沒有,但編程必須有的東西,例如函數(shù)、結(jié)構(gòu)和連線等 [17]。它的功能是對(duì)前面板上的控件進(jìn)行定義、操作和連線以實(shí)現(xiàn)虛擬儀器的功能,是 LabVIEW程序設(shè)計(jì)的核心。這一界面上有用戶輸入和顯示輸出兩類對(duì)象,具體表現(xiàn)有開關(guān)、旋鈕、圖形以及其他控制和顯示對(duì)象。所有的 VI,它包括前面板、程序框圖圖以及圖標(biāo) /連結(jié)器三部分。因此對(duì) USB通信開發(fā)來說,要做的僅僅是USB主機(jī)和 USB器件的具體應(yīng)用程序開發(fā),以及 API函數(shù)的直接調(diào)用。 USBXpress開發(fā)套件提供的各種軟件庫通過一系列函數(shù)實(shí)現(xiàn)單片機(jī)端和 PC機(jī)端的應(yīng)用程序接口(API)。 U S B X p r e s s 主 機(jī) 驅(qū) 動(dòng)U S B X p r e s s 器 件 驅(qū) 動(dòng)應(yīng) 用 程 序A P I應(yīng) 用 程 序P C 機(jī)單 片 機(jī) 圖 12 USB通信原理圖 由于有了 Silicon Laboratories公司提供的 USBX—press的開發(fā)套件,上述驅(qū)動(dòng)以及應(yīng)用程序的編寫變得極為簡(jiǎn)便。顯然,要完成 USB 通信需要 PC 機(jī)端 (USB 主機(jī) )與 C805IF340 單片機(jī)端 (USB器件 )共同協(xié)作。 USB 外設(shè)開發(fā)除了硬件設(shè)計(jì)外,大部分工作集中在固件編程和 PC 機(jī)端驅(qū)動(dòng)程序以及用戶應(yīng)用程序的開發(fā)上。 LabVIEW 將廣泛的數(shù)據(jù)采集、分析與顯示功能集中在了同一個(gè)環(huán)境中,讓開發(fā)人員可以在自己的平臺(tái)上無縫地集成一套完整的應(yīng)用方案 [4] 。 LabVIEW 是一個(gè)具有革命性的圖形化開發(fā)環(huán)境。它包含高速流水線的 8051 兼容微控制器核,運(yùn)行速率可以高達(dá) 48 MIPS; 64 KB 的芯片內(nèi)建閃存與 5 376 字節(jié)的 RAM,片上外設(shè)引腳可以軟件配置, 70 的指令可以在 1 個(gè)或 2 個(gè)機(jī)器周期中執(zhí)行; USB 功能控制器具有完整的 USB 2. 0 認(rèn)證,支持全速與低速操作,可以用于大多數(shù) USB 外設(shè)設(shè)計(jì)。簽于此,應(yīng)用包含片上 USB 控制器的 C8O51F340 單片機(jī)和進(jìn)行 PC 機(jī)端 GUI 用戶應(yīng)用程序開發(fā)的 LabVIEW 軟件為基礎(chǔ)的一種基于 API 實(shí)現(xiàn) USB 通信的開發(fā)方法,從而了解和熟悉 USB 外設(shè)的 API 開發(fā)方法。采樣定理在數(shù)字式遙測(cè)系統(tǒng)、 時(shí)分制遙測(cè)系統(tǒng) 、信息處理、數(shù)字通信和采樣控制理論等領(lǐng)域得到廣泛的應(yīng)用 [3]。 1948 年信息論的創(chuàng)始人 明確地說明并正式作為定理引用,因此在許多文獻(xiàn)中又稱為 香農(nóng)采樣定理 。采樣定理是 1928 年由 美國 電信工程師 ,因此稱為奈奎斯特采樣定理。 1924 年 奈奎斯特 (Nyquist)就推導(dǎo)出在 理想低通信道 的最高 碼元傳輸速率 的公式 : 理想低通信道的最高碼元傳輸速率 B=2W Baud (其中 W 是理想 ) 圖 11模擬采樣示意圖 采樣定理: 西安工程大學(xué)本科畢業(yè)設(shè)計(jì) (論文 ) 4 理想信道的極限信息速率(信道容量) C = B * log2 N ( bps ) 采樣過程所應(yīng)遵循的規(guī)律,又稱 取樣定理 、抽樣定理。另外, V. A. Kotelnikov 也對(duì)這個(gè)定理做了重要貢獻(xiàn)。 E. T. Whittaker(1915 年發(fā)表的統(tǒng)計(jì)理論 ),克勞德 然后細(xì)化到每個(gè)模塊的方案如何選擇,最后根據(jù)設(shè)計(jì)的方案進(jìn)行了整個(gè)論文的章節(jié)安排。第五章是系統(tǒng)設(shè)計(jì)的結(jié)論與展望,本章對(duì)結(jié)論作了詳細(xì)的說明 ,展望是對(duì)于本次設(shè)計(jì)中的問題提出了一些個(gè)人見解 。第三章是系統(tǒng)軟件的設(shè)計(jì),針對(duì)對(duì)系統(tǒng)軟件的功能、總體設(shè)計(jì)和各個(gè)部分的具體設(shè)計(jì)實(shí)現(xiàn)作詳細(xì)的介紹。第一章提出設(shè)計(jì)中的一些基本原理和相關(guān)硬件、軟件的基本介紹。 西安工程大學(xué)本科畢業(yè)設(shè)計(jì) (論文 ) 2 針對(duì)以上現(xiàn)狀,本設(shè)計(jì)提出以下方案:總體設(shè)計(jì)主要分為上位機(jī)和下位機(jī)兩部分,下位機(jī)主要是利用 C8051F340單片機(jī)對(duì)信號(hào)采樣并將得到的信號(hào)通過 USB接口發(fā)送給 PC 機(jī),上位機(jī)主要是由 PC 機(jī)端的 GUI 界面進(jìn)行波形顯示、頻譜分析,而且 PC 機(jī)端的 GUI 界面主要利用 LabVIEW 來實(shí)現(xiàn)。使用它進(jìn)行原理研究、設(shè)計(jì)、測(cè)試并實(shí)現(xiàn)儀器系統(tǒng)時(shí),可以大大提高工作效率。因此, LabVIEW 是 一個(gè)面向最終用戶的工具。 LabVIEW 的圖形化源代碼在某種程度上類似于流程圖,因此又被稱作程序框圖。使用圖標(biāo)和連線,可以通過編程對(duì)前面板上的對(duì)象進(jìn)行控制。 LabVIEW 提供很多外觀與傳統(tǒng)儀器(如示波器、萬用表)類似的控件,可用來方便地創(chuàng)建用戶界面?;?LabVIEW 的虛擬信號(hào)波形顯示分析器具有機(jī)交互性好、易于操作等特點(diǎn),能夠廣泛的應(yīng)用與于科研、生產(chǎn)等領(lǐng)域 [1]。 LabVIEW作為一個(gè)圖形化編程軟件,是開發(fā)測(cè)試系統(tǒng)的一種功能強(qiáng)大、方便快捷的編程工具。目前 , 該開發(fā)軟件在國際測(cè)試、測(cè)控行業(yè)比較流行 ,在國內(nèi)的測(cè)控領(lǐng)域也得到廣泛應(yīng)用。虛擬儀器以軟件為核心 , 其軟件又以美國 NI公司的 LabVIEW虛擬儀器軟件開發(fā)平臺(tái)最為常用。虛擬儀器是指 :利用現(xiàn)有的 PC 機(jī),加上特殊設(shè)計(jì)的儀器硬件和專用軟件 , 形成既有普通儀器的基本功能 , 又有一般儀器所沒有的特殊功能的新型儀器。 關(guān)鍵詞 : C8051F340,頻譜分析, LabVIEW, PC 機(jī), USB 西安工程大學(xué)本科畢業(yè)設(shè)計(jì) (論文 ) 西安工程大學(xué)本科畢業(yè)設(shè)計(jì) (論文 ) ABSTRACT Traditional oscilloscope function pletely dependent on hardware implementation with single function and the high cost of maintenance, it is more important function cannot change once established. Using the LabVIEW virtual instrument is made of the virtual technology, puter technology, bus technology, and software technology closely together. It use puter powerful digital processing ability realize the instrument most of the functions, breaking the traditional instruments of the framework, formed a new instrument mode. To this end, this paper presents a low frequency analog signal display analyzer design. Low frequency analog signal analyzer design is mainly divided into two parts of the upper mac
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1